The role of hot primary air in thermal power plants
APH is used in a thermal power plant to absorb the waste energy of flue gas to reduce coal consumption which increases the efficiency of the power plant. To achieve maximum boiler efficiency maximum possible useful heat must be removed from the gas before it leaves the APH. . A hot primary-air pipe system is the bridge connecting an air-preheater with a coal mill in power generation stations. Primary Air ( pa fans) and Secondary Air in Boiler For the combustion of any fuel to take place, 3 basic ingredients are needed: Air provided. . The regenerative air preheater absorbs waste heat from flue gas. The 150 MW Andasol solar power station is a commercial parabolic trough solar thermal power plant, located in Spain. The Andasol plant uses tanks of molten salt to store captured solar energy so that it can continue generating electricity when the sun is not shining. [1] This is a list of energy. . China s solar air power generation
29 -- China's combined installed capacity of wind and solar power has exceeded 1,800 gigawatts for the first time last year, as its gap with thermal power, whose primary sources are fossil fuels, continues to expand. . China installed a record 315 GW (AC) of new solar capacity in 2025, lifting cumulative installed PV capacity to 1. 2 TW and pushing non-fossil power sources past thermal generation for the first time.
